On Sunday, April 19, 2026, the Provincial Judicial Police Department in Casablanca opened a judicial investigation under the supervision of the competent public prosecutor’s office to determine the circumstances surrounding the involvement of a female citizen from a sub-Saharan African country in a case related to international drug trafficking.
According to available information, customs screening procedures at Mohammed V International Airport led to the suspect’s arrest immediately upon her arrival on a flight from Freetown, the capital of Sierra Leone.
The search revealed that she was in possession, among her personal belongings, of two packages of cocaine weighing a total of 7 kilograms and 330 grams.
The suspect was handed over to judicial police officers and placed in pretrial detention pending the judicial investigation, which is being conducted under the supervision of the competent public prosecutor’s office, in order to uncover all possible ramifications of this criminal activity, both nationally and internationally, and to identify the other alleged accomplices.
This operation is part of the ongoing efforts by security services to combat international drug trafficking networks and strengthen surveillance of the Kingdom’s border crossings.
